Psalms 69:3

Context

69:3 I am exhausted from shouting for help;

my throat is sore; 1 

my eyes grow tired of looking for my God. 2 

Psalms 141:1

Context
Psalm 141 3 

A psalm of David.

141:1 O Lord, I cry out to you. Come quickly to me!

Pay attention to me when I cry out to you!

[69:3]  1 tn Or perhaps “raw”; Heb “burned; enflamed.”

[69:3]  2 tn Heb “my eyes fail from waiting for my God.” The psalmist has intently kept his eyes open, looking for God to intervene, but now his eyes are watery and bloodshot, impairing his vision.

[141:1]  3 sn Psalm 141. The psalmist asks God to protect him from sin and from sinful men.
